The Santa Fe Saints failed to score in either game as the Chipola Indians swept the doubleheader in Gainesville Sunday afternoon winning game one 2-0 and game two 5-0.
Chipola improved to 22-4 and dominated the Saints hitters in both games.
"We didn't hit very well today," said SF head coach Lindsay Fico. "The combination of very talented pitching and lack of offensive adjustments make for a long day in the box."
The bright spot for the Saints was freshman pitcher Cris Beasley who was the hard luck loser in the opener when she held the number four team in state, number six team in the nation to just one earned run.
"Cris Beasley pitched great today," said Fico. "She pitched to a very tough lineup and held her own. I'm proud how she has grown with every outing."
SF (14-12) will travel to Avon Park, Fla. for a rematch against South Florida State College on Thursday.
